The challenge of successfully guiding customers from their current state (A) to their desired goal state (B) is a central task in marketing, especially in email marketing. It is crucial to understand the needs of the target audience precisely and communicate suitable solutions. In this guide, you will learn how to increase conversion rates and motivate your customers to achieve their goals through targeted email communication.

Step-by-Step Guide
1. Understand your customer's journey
To guide your customers from A to B, you first need to find out where they currently stand and what their goal is. Start by outlining the current position of your target audience. Ask yourself, "What does my customer want to achieve?" Be specific and consider whether the customer is willing to take steps to get there.
For example, if your customer wants to earn money online, are they already employed, or have they gained initial experience in online business? By gathering this information, you can develop a tailored plan that directly addresses the needs of your target audience.

2. Define clear goals
The next task is to define your customer's exact goal. Instead of using vague formulations like "I want to become independent," you should set specific numerical goals. For example, "I want to earn 2500 euros gross per month." Clear goal setting allows you to craft your email content precisely and make it relevant and appealing to your customers.

3. Consider your customers' problems
The path from A to B can be complicated by various obstacles. Ponder on the difficulties your customers could face on their journey. For instance, lack of discipline or unhealthy eating habits could be hurdles for someone aiming to get fit.
By analyzing people's problems, you can create valuable content that assists them. You could, like, provide tips on healthy eating or improving discipline. It is particularly important to offer specific solutions that support your customers on their path to their goal.
4. Get to know your customers
The fourth strategy is to understand your customers better. What prevents them from moving from A to B? Are there external factors limiting their decision-making, such as an employer's negative attitude towards a side job? By understanding these barriers, you can present targeted solutions and help your customers overcome these obstacles.
5. Support your customers effectively
To make your emails valuable to your customers, the communication should always convey: "I will help you for free and give you the tools you need to achieve your goal." Personalized messages offering specific solutions or tools are more likely to be perceived and appreciated.
It is essential for your customers to feel like they are building a relationship with you. Send emails regularly, offering your help and showing that you are there for them. This not only increases the read rate but also ensures that they do not unsubscribe from your emails.
6. Make it personal
Ensure that your communication sounds as natural as possible. Avoid cliché marketing phrases and always engage on a personal level. Show your customers that you provide real solutions without hidden intentions. This builds trust and convinces your target audience to follow you.
